搜索引擎使用大量的数据来提供搜索结果,包括索引数据、用户数据、爬虫数据、排名数据、点击数据等。索引数据是最基础的部分,它包含了搜索引擎从互联网上抓取到的所有网页内容,并通过复杂的算法进行分类和存储。搜索引擎爬虫会定期访问和更新这些数据,以确保信息的及时性和准确性。索引数据的质量直接影响到搜索结果的相关性和准确性,用户在搜索时能够快速找到所需信息很大程度上依赖于此。
一、索引数据
索引数据是搜索引擎的核心,它相当于一个巨大的数据库,储存了互联网上的各种信息。搜索引擎爬虫通过不断抓取网页,将网页内容进行分词、分类、存储,形成索引。这些数据的质量和新鲜度直接影响到搜索结果的相关性和准确性。为了提高用户体验,搜索引擎不仅要收录大量的网页,还要对内容进行分析和筛选,确保用户能够快速找到所需的信息。
索引数据的更新频率也是一个关键因素。搜索引擎会根据网站的更新速度和重要性,设定不同的抓取频率,以便及时更新索引数据。例如,新闻网站通常会被频繁抓取,而一些静态的、更新较少的网站则会被较少访问。
此外,索引数据的存储和检索效率也是影响搜索引擎性能的重要因素。搜索引擎使用复杂的算法和数据结构,如倒排索引、哈希表等,来提高数据的存储和检索效率,使用户在搜索时能够快速获得结果。
二、用户数据
用户数据是搜索引擎优化的重要依据,通过收集和分析用户的搜索行为、点击行为、停留时间等,可以了解用户的需求和偏好,从而提供更加个性化和精准的搜索结果。用户数据包括搜索历史、点击率、停留时间、跳出率、地理位置等。
用户数据的收集通常通过多种方式实现,包括浏览器Cookie、用户注册信息、搜索日志等。这些数据不仅可以帮助搜索引擎改进算法,还可以用于广告投放、用户画像等多种应用。例如,通过分析用户的搜索历史,搜索引擎可以预测用户的兴趣和需求,提供更加精准的搜索结果和广告推荐。
此外,用户数据的隐私保护也是一个重要问题。搜索引擎公司通常会采取多种措施,如数据加密、匿名化处理等,来保护用户的隐私和数据安全。用户也可以通过设置隐私选项,控制数据的收集和使用范围。
三、爬虫数据
爬虫数据是搜索引擎从互联网上抓取到的网页内容,这些内容经过处理和分类后,成为索引数据的一部分。爬虫数据的数量和质量直接影响到搜索引擎的覆盖范围和结果的准确性。爬虫的工作原理是通过链接的爬取,不断发现新的网页,并将其内容抓取下来。
爬虫的抓取策略和算法也是影响数据质量的重要因素。例如,一些高级爬虫可以识别和避免重复内容,优先抓取高质量和热门网站,提高数据的有效性。此外,爬虫还需要处理一些复杂的情况,如动态网页、JavaScript生成的内容、robots.txt文件的限制等。
为了提高抓取效率和覆盖范围,搜索引擎通常会部署大量的爬虫,并使用分布式计算和存储技术。这些技术可以支持大规模的数据抓取和处理,确保搜索引擎能够及时更新和扩展索引数据。
四、排名数据
排名数据是搜索引擎根据复杂的算法和规则,对网页进行排序和评分的结果。排名数据直接影响用户在搜索结果中看到的网页顺序,进而影响用户的点击行为和满意度。排名算法通常考虑多个因素,如网页内容的相关性、权威性、用户体验等。
搜索引擎公司通常不会公开其排名算法的具体细节,但一些已知的因素包括关键词密度、页面加载速度、外部链接的数量和质量、用户点击率等。为了提高排名,网站管理员可以进行搜索引擎优化(SEO),如优化网页内容、提高网站速度、增加外部链接等。
排名数据的更新频率也是一个重要因素。搜索引擎会根据用户行为和网页的变化,定期更新排名数据,以确保搜索结果的准确性和时效性。例如,如果一个网页突然变得非常受欢迎,搜索引擎可能会提升其排名,以便用户更容易找到。
五、点击数据
点击数据是用户在搜索结果页面上的点击行为,这些数据可以反映用户对搜索结果的满意度和兴趣。点击数据包括点击次数、点击率、点击时间、点击路径等,可以帮助搜索引擎优化搜索结果和广告投放。
通过分析点击数据,搜索引擎可以了解哪些搜索结果最受用户欢迎,从而调整排名算法,提高用户体验。例如,如果某个搜索结果的点击率非常高,搜索引擎可能会提升其排名,反之则可能降低排名。此外,点击数据还可以用于广告效果评估,帮助广告主优化广告投放策略。
点击数据的收集通常通过搜索引擎的服务器日志和用户终端的浏览器Cookie实现。这些数据可以实时或离线处理,生成各种统计和分析报告,支持搜索引擎的优化和改进。
六、其他相关数据
除了上述主要数据外,搜索引擎还使用许多其他相关数据来优化搜索结果和用户体验。这些数据包括地理位置数据、设备数据、社交数据、语音数据等。例如,地理位置数据可以帮助搜索引擎提供本地化的搜索结果,设备数据可以优化移动搜索体验,社交数据可以反映用户的社交关系和影响力,语音数据可以支持语音搜索和语音识别功能。
地理位置数据通过GPS、IP地址等方式获取,可以帮助搜索引擎提供更加个性化和本地化的搜索结果。例如,用户搜索“餐厅”时,搜索引擎可以根据用户的地理位置推荐附近的餐厅,提高搜索结果的相关性和实用性。
设备数据包括用户使用的设备类型、操作系统、浏览器等,可以帮助搜索引擎优化搜索结果的展示和交互体验。例如,移动设备用户的搜索结果页面可能会优先显示适合移动设备浏览的网站,提高用户体验。
社交数据通过用户的社交媒体账号和活动获取,可以反映用户的社交关系和影响力。例如,用户在社交媒体上分享和点赞的内容可以作为搜索引擎的排名因素之一,提高搜索结果的相关性和权威性。
语音数据通过语音识别技术获取,可以支持语音搜索和语音助手功能。例如,用户通过语音助手进行搜索,搜索引擎可以通过语音数据分析用户的意图和需求,提供更加精准和便捷的搜索结果。
综上所述,搜索引擎使用大量的多种数据来优化搜索结果和用户体验,这些数据的质量和处理效率直接影响搜索引擎的性能和用户满意度。了解和掌握这些数据的特点和应用,可以帮助网站管理员和SEO从业者更好地进行搜索引擎优化,提高网站的曝光率和流量。
相关问答FAQs:
搜索引擎是什么数据?
搜索引擎是一个复杂的系统,它通过互联网收集、整理和存储大量信息。这些信息可以被分为几种主要类型。首先,搜索引擎会抓取网页内容,提取文本、图像、视频和其他多媒体信息。这些数据经过解析后,会被存储在搜索引擎的数据库中,以便用户进行搜索时能够迅速找到相关结果。
其次,搜索引擎还会收集用户行为数据。这包括用户的搜索查询、点击率、浏览时长和其他与搜索相关的互动信息。这些数据帮助搜索引擎了解用户的偏好和需求,从而优化搜索结果,提升用户体验。
另外,搜索引擎还会分析网站的结构和链接关系。这种分析有助于确定网站的权威性和相关性,从而影响其在搜索结果中的排名。通过这些数据的综合分析,搜索引擎能够生成更加精准和相关的搜索结果,满足用户的需求。
搜索引擎如何处理数据?
搜索引擎的工作流程涉及多个步骤,包括抓取、索引、排名和呈现。抓取是指搜索引擎使用爬虫程序(也称为网络蜘蛛)访问互联网上的网页,提取内容并将其存储。爬虫会跟随网页中的链接,发现新页面并更新已有页面的数据。
在抓取后,搜索引擎会对收集到的数据进行索引。索引是将信息整理成一种可以快速查询的形式。每个网页的内容、关键词、元数据等都会被记录在数据库中,以便在用户输入搜索查询时能够迅速找到匹配的结果。
排名是搜索引擎的核心部分。搜索引擎使用复杂的算法来决定哪些网页在用户搜索时最为相关。这些算法考虑了多种因素,包括关键词的匹配度、网页的质量、用户的历史行为和网站的权威性。最终,搜索引擎会将最相关的结果呈现给用户。
在搜索结果呈现阶段,搜索引擎不仅显示网页链接,还可能包括图片、视频、新闻、购物信息等。这种多样化的结果形式旨在提供更好的用户体验,满足不同用户的搜索需求。
搜索引擎如何影响数据的获取?
搜索引擎在信息获取方面扮演着重要角色。用户通过输入关键词,搜索引擎能够迅速过滤出大量信息,提供最相关的结果。这种便捷性使得信息获取变得更加高效。用户不再需要逐一访问网站,而是可以通过搜索引擎快速找到所需的资料。
然而,搜索引擎的运作也带来了信息获取的挑战。由于算法的复杂性,某些网站可能因为技术原因或内容质量不高而难以在搜索结果中排名靠前。这可能导致用户无法获得全面的信息。此外,搜索引擎的结果往往受到商业利益的影响,某些广告或赞助内容可能会优先显示,影响用户的选择。
为了应对这些挑战,用户应当提高信息素养,学会使用多种搜索技巧,从不同的渠道获取信息。了解搜索引擎的工作原理,可以帮助用户更好地利用这一工具,找到更准确和全面的数据。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。